Gyokeres wants Premier League move for ‘revenge’ and says he is as good as Kane and Haaland

Arsenal target Viktor Gyokeres says he wants to play in the Premier League for “revenge” and ranks himself among the world’s best strikers.

The Gunners are understood to be edging closer to agreeing a deal to sign the in-demand striker, with current Sporting CP said to be demanding £69million plus add-ons as talks over a move continue.

Gyokeres, who was previously at Brighton before impressing in the Championship with Coventry prior to his move to Portugal, has reportedly not returned to Sporting training as he looks to push through a return to England.

And in an interview with French newspaper L’Equipe, the Sweden international has reinforced his desire to make his mark in the Premier League.

“It’s one of the biggest leagues in Europe,” Gyokeres, who moved to Sporting having shone in the Championship, said.

“I spent several years there without being able to play a single match. So, of course, it’s something I would like to do. It would be a great revenge.”

Key day in the Viktor Gyokeres saga. Sporting have told Gyokeres he must return to training today, but the Swedish striker is expected to refuse having made his position clear to the club all summer.

Sporting already informed Arsenal they want €70m fixed plus add-ons.

Gyokeres on Arsenal links: ‘They need to really want me’

The 27-year-old has also attracted interest from Manchester United but has stressed the need for whichever club he joins to be desperate to sign him.

“It’s football, you never know. I’m not thinking about it, we’ll see what happens.” he said.

“If something is going to happen, it will happen. The most important thing for me is to play for a club that really wants me.”

Gyokeres: ‘I’m level with Kane and Haaland’

Gyokeres has an outstanding record since joining from Coventry in 2023, scoring 97 goals in 102 games, and now feels he is among the world’s best strikers, including Harry Kane, Erling Haaland and Robert Lewandowski.

“I’m definitely one of them,” he said. “It’s difficult to rank me but yes, I’m at the same table as them now.

“What I managed to do at Sporting, I’m convinced I can do anywhere. You haven’t seen the best of Gyokeres yet.”
